Avalon Advanced Materials Inc. recently shared a corporate presentation highlighting its strategic initiatives and partnerships in the critical minerals sector. The company is leveraging its diverse portfolio to cater to high-demand markets such as electric vehicles, renewable energy storage, and advanced technologies. Key projects include the Nechalacho Project, aimed at supplying zirconium and rare-earth minerals, and the Lake Superior Lithium Project, which focuses on supporting the electric vehicle market with a lithium hydroxide processing facility in Thunder Bay, Ontario. Avalon has formed strategic partnerships with industry leaders like Sibelco, Metso Corp., and Qualcomm to enhance its market reach and foster innovation.
